The world is grappling with an ongoing energy crisis primarily driven by the need to reduce emissions while combatting climate change. With heavy reliance on fossil fuels, the global carbon footprint threatens not only the environment but human health.

Insufficient measures to address this issue have made global warming, air pollution, and resource depletion more serious than ever before. Fortunately, businesses and other organizations can do their part by employing energy alternatives that can reduce emissions and mitigate climate change while aligning with sustainable business plans and ESG principles.

Here are five ways businesses can help combat the energy crisis:

1. Investing in energy-efficient practices and integrating technologies like heat pumps

Commercial heat pumps and other energy efficient solutions optimize energy usage and reduce greenhouse gas emissions which are crucial to addressing the energy crisis. These machines deliver advanced technology that utilizes the natural heat from the environment to warm up or cool down your home or business. Installing an industrial heat pump can help reduce energy bills, drastically reduce carbon footprints, and lessen the environmental impact of traditional heating and cooling methods. Additionally, heat pumps typically run quietly and efficiently, generating the same amount of heating or cooling, but consuming less electricity than conventional systems.

2.Manufacturing and deploying green energy technologies

The precision manufacturing industry plays a vital role in the advancement of clean energy technologies. For instance, the development of solar panels and wind turbines has revolutionized the way we generate and distribute energy. These innovative technologies harness the power of natural, renewable sources such as sunlight and wind, eliminating the need to burn fossil fuels. As these technologies are adopted on a larger scale, not only do they benefit the environment, but they also create more green jobs while contributing to economic growth.

3.Research and development create innovative solutions

Manufacturing also supports the global shift toward sustainable energy by embracing innovative energy technologies worldwide. For instance, by allocating resources while exploring hydrogen fuel cells or implementing carbon capture systems, manufacturers can effectively reduce production expenses while progressively enhancing their performance capabilities. Similarly, heat pump manufacturers can continually refine their machines to be more efficient and consume even less energy.

Investing in green energy technologies ensures the long-term sustainability of our planet. Governments, businesses, investors, and individuals can all play a significant role in driving the transition to clean energy solutions that will decarbonize economies and mitigate climate change. Supporting research and development, incentivizing the adoption of renewable energy, and encouraging sustainable practices can all help achieve a sustainable future.

4.Prioritizing decarbonization and embracing renewables

Decarbonization is an essential step in addressing the energy crisis. Renewable energy sources such as solar, wind, hydro, geothermal power, and others offers sustainability and global-ready availability. Encouraging the use of renewable energy sources also means reducing dependence on non-renewable resources and mitigating air pollution as well as greenhouse gas emissions, and their associated health hazards. Additionally, renewable energy is cost-effective, and as costs continue to decline, it becomes even more viable as an option for energy consumers, businesses, and governments alike.

5.Promoting sustainability

Sustainable development practices ensure that the well-being of current and future generations is balanced with economic, social, and environmental considerations. Implementing sustainability measures, like increasing energy efficiency, improving conservation efforts, and focusing on energy waste reduction, promotes responsible use of resources, reduces negative environmental impacts, and creates long-term value for stakeholders.
